120a Eastham Rake

    120A, EASTHAM RAKE, WIRRAL, CH62 9AD

    This detached freehold property on Eastham Rake last sold in August 2017 for £268,500. Based on price growth in the CH62 district since then, its estimated current value is £384,452 — placing it in the 65th percentile nationally and the 94th percentile within CH62. The property covers 121 m² (1,302 sq ft), giving an estimated value of £3,177 per m². The EPC rating is C, with a potential rating of C.

    District Context — CH62

    CH62 covers Bromborough, Bebington, and surrounding areas on the Wirral Peninsula in Merseyside, south of Liverpool. It is a long-established residential district with good transport links and a mix of suburban and semi-rural character.
